Output 2826fc21c8bdad91828084af7801b2904af08e47c6d6e93cfb41806c24a4d471:4

value
54008608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d641fa709f790bb37dac4d58ba88bcdfce983d0 OP_EQUAL
address
MKLAe81S7RjDHuR41wic1RcB1riAR4njiL
transaction
2826fc21c8bdad91828084af7801b2904af08e47c6d6e93cfb41806c24a4d471
spent
true